Chemonics is recruiting a Lab Warehousing and Distribution Advisor, to be based in Maputo, Mozambique.
Duties
- Warehousing: Assist with the revision of the existing laboratory commodities description in the MACS system and lab items standardization (approved national list of lab products): codification and item description
 
- Support CMAM with the integration of the lab products into the existing information systems (including unit price)
 
- Assist CMAM warehousing team with reception control and distribution activities
 
- Ensure the follow up of pre/expiry lab items with CMAM and DCL on monthly basis
 
- Support CMAM with the implementation of annual physical inventory and perpetual inventory for laboratory commodities
 
- Assist with volumetric data collection and analysis (including cold chain)
 
- Information Systems: Ensure that MACS documentation is available for any reception and distribution of lab products
 
- Assist CMAM and PSM with the availability of monthly stock and distribution reports
 
- To assist with Labtool setting changes: adding laboratory, equipment or product
 
- Work with IS tools including MACS, Ferramenta Central, and Labtool
 
- Distribution: To assist with distribution activity of PEPFAR & GF supported items
 
- To provide a technical support to CMAM/DCL in distribution plan elaboration (e.g: distribution of DBS kits)
 
- Monthly data collection & Analysis (lmis report)
 
- Receive and analyze the data reported from the laboratory PEPFAR supported network on a monthly basis
 
- Insertion data (consumption, stock on hand) in the Labtool on monthly basis
 
- Update the list (labs contacts for each lab, lab equipment) as soon as a new information comes up: name of technician, contact detaill
 
- Once data is inserted into Labtool, to verify data quality and completeness
 
- To ensure that data corrections are made in the Labtool and with the labs
 
- Field Support: Travel to lab sites to provide supportive supervision and on‐the‐job training, in collaboration with the DCL and other MOH staff in issues in supply chain management
 
Requisites
- Bachelor’s degree in a relevant field
 
- At least 3 years of relevant work experience
 
- Experience working on a USAID or donor-funded project required
 
- Fluency in Portuguese and advanced English is required
